  2. The 1992 Cricket World Cup (known as the Benson & Hedges World Cup 1992 for sponsorship reasons) was the fifth Cricket World Cup, the premier One Day International cricket tournament for men's national teams, organised by the International Cricket Council (ICC).

  7. Feb 22, 2018 · The 1992 Cricket World Cup was a tournament full of firsts. Coloured kits made their debut, as did white balls, while it was the first time the men’s World Cup had been held in the southern hemisphere.
